Otautahi Aroha wa Salam: March 15 Scholarship
Award Amount
Up to $6,000 per 120 points of enrolment

Brief Description:
This scholarship supports those directly affected by the 2019 Christchurch Mosque attacks to study at Te Whare Wānanga o Waitaha | University of Canterbury, or another accredited education provider.
Value/Benefits:
Up to $6,000 per 120 points of enrolment.
Level of Study:
Any
Opening Date:
The scholarship will be advertised as funds become available.
Tenure:
Duration of programme/course enrolment
Number Available Annually:
At least one
Applicable Enrolment During Tenure:
Full or part-time enrolment in any UC programme or course, including certificates and diplomas, short-courses and UC Online; scholarships may also be used for courses or programs at any accredited educational institution in New Zealand or internationally.
Special Requirements
: Applicants must be survivors of the 2019 Christchurch Mosque attacks or the family members or descendants of the victims and survivors of the attacks.

Application Information:
Applicants should submit enquiries to the Scholarships Office at scholarships@canterbury.ac.nz. Applicants will be asked to prepare a statements for the selection committee outlining their circumstances, what they intend to study and what they hope to achieve.
